Description:
The current default color scheme looks very dated LibreOffice also abused a lot
of gray tones that makes it look somewhat dated and not very functional, since
many of its elements may be confused.
For example: The table lines are confused with page boundaries, the grid,
guides, field/index/tables shadings, etc. In other elements with the same
color, it is confusing, such as automatic page break vs manual.
Some related bugs are: Bug 87933 and Bug 85450
